The Service Has a Woman's Face

Summary by Revista Merca2.0
Last week I had the opportunity to visit my beloved city of Tijuana, to know and live closely one of the most inspiring cases I have seen in the service industry in Mexico, and probably in Latin America, it is the service stations called Rendichicas. A chain of more than 100 units in several cities in the northeast of the Mexican Republic that has managed to differentiate itself in a sector where even if it is a product of very great need such a…
